Title | Solution structure of the C-terminally encoded peptide of the plant parasitic nematode Meloidogyne hapla - CEP11 | ||||||
Components | CEP11 | ||||||
Keywords | HORMONE / CEP / Meloidogyne / root-knot nematode / CLE | ||||||
Function / homology | nitrate import / regulation of root development / regulation of leaf morphogenesis / hormone activity / extracellular region / Putative encoded peptide Function and homology information | ||||||
Biological species | Meloidogyne hapla (invertebrata) | ||||||
Method | SOLUTION NMR / simulated annealing | ||||||
Model details | lowest energy, model1 | ||||||
Authors | Bobay, B.G. / DiGennaro, P. / Bird, D.M. | ||||||
Citation | Journal: Febs Lett. / Year: 2013 Title: Solution NMR studies of the plant peptide hormone CEP inform function. Authors: Bobay, B.G. / Digennaro, P. / Scholl, E. / Imin, N. / Djordjevic, M.A. / McK Bird, D. | ||||||

-Components
#1: Protein/peptide | Mass: 1522.644 Da / Num. of mol.: 1 / Source method: obtained synthetically Details: Synthetic peptide with modification of hydroxy-proline at positions 4 and 11 Source: (synth.) Meloidogyne hapla (invertebrata) / References: UniProt: G7K427*PLUS |

-Experimental details
-Experiment
Experiment | Method: SOLUTION NMR | ||||||||||||||||||||
---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|
NMR experiment |
| ||||||||||||||||||||
NMR details | Text: NOESY collected at 50 and 300 ms ; TOCSY collected at 30 and 80 ms |
-Sample preparation
Details | Contents: 4 mg/mL protein, 10 uM DSS, 90% H2O/10% D2O / Solvent system: 90% H2O/10% D2O | |||||||||
---|---|---|---|---|---|---|---|---|---|---|
Sample |
| |||||||||
Sample conditions | Ionic strength: 0 / pH: 7.0 / Pressure: ambient / Temperature: 298 K |
-NMR measurement
NMR spectrometer | Type: Bruker Avance / Manufacturer: Bruker / Model: Avance / Field strength: 700 MHz |
---|
-Processing
NMR software |
| |||||||||||||||||||||
---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|
Refinement | Method: simulated annealing / Software ordinal: 1 | |||||||||||||||||||||
NMR representative | Selection criteria: lowest energy | |||||||||||||||||||||
NMR ensemble | Conformer selection criteria: structures with the lowest energy Conformers calculated total number: 10 / Conformers submitted total number: 10 |
